PolioPlus, the most ambitious program in Rotary’s history, is the volunteer arm of the global partnership dedicated to eradicating polio. For more than 20 years, Rotary has led the private sector in the global effort to rid the world of this crippling disease. Today, PolioPlus and its role in the initiative is recognized worldwide as a model of public-private cooperation in pursuit of a humanitarian goal.
The Commitment to Service Award (C2SA) is the Montgomery Sunrise Rotary Club's annual fundraising event. Each year for over 5 years now, Montgomery Sunrise has hosted this event to honor an individual in the Montgomery / River Region area for their efforts and achievments in serving their community. This award ceremony includes a fine dining dinner and a Roast of the honoree by several individuals who have known them for some time and can share with us some of their memories of the relationship they have with our honoree and have a little laugh at their expense as well. The evening also includes a silent auction as well. Funds raised by corporate sponsorship, ticket sales and the silent auction are used to support a selected charitable organization who is also a part of the evening's events, sharing information and images of their work.
